The Valkyries enter the final homestand with a magic number of four to clinch a playoff spot, combining Valkyries wins and Sparks losses. The coach remains focused on the team's own preparation rather than external scenarios. Players emphasize continuing the team approach that has driven success. The Valkyries play New York, Dallas and Minnesota at Chase Center before finishing on the road. Several opponents face significant injuries, including Caitlin Clark out since July and Paige Bueckers dealing with back and calf issues, while the Liberty contend with multiple injuries. The coach stresses player care amid a leaguewide injury wave; Minnesota may rest players if clinched.
